Abstract

A gated, pulsed laser spectrofluorometer is provided analyzing subpicogram amounts of fluorescent substance in sample volumes of less than 10 .mu.l. This is accomplished by repetitively exciting the fluorescent sample with a subnanosecond, intensive excitation radiation pulse and by gating a fluorescence radiation detector output signal so that detection starts after the excitation radiation pulse has decayed to a negligible intensity and ends when the fluorescence radiation detector output signal caused by the fluorescence emission from the sample has decayed to a level comparable to the electrical noise level of the electronic measuring apparatus connected to said fluorescence radiation detector.
